What is Diversity?

SUNY Office of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ion Diversity Statement

Diversity can be broadly defined to include all aspects of human difference, including but not limited to, age, disability, race, ethnicity, gender, gender expression and identity, language heritage, learning style, national origin, sexual orientation, religion, social-economic status, status as a veteran and world-view. The Office of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ion focuses in particular on achieving equal access, meaningful academic and intellectual inclusion in curriculum, research, and service, and holistic integration into the academic culture of higher education at all levels for New York State’s underrepresented populations and students who are economically disadvantaged.

Buffalo State Statement of Principle on Diversity

Buffalo State supports diversity of thought, diversity of experience, and diversity of values. The university is dedicated to a visible commitment to these ideals by affirming and respecting differences in all interactions. Toward this goal, the university provides equitable opportunity and access through innovative recruiting, professional development, and education programs that enrich the total academic experience and enhance the quality of life.

Our Mission

The Office of Diversity, Equity, Inclusion, and Access (DEIA) aims to advance, support, and celebrate inclusive excellence, diversity, social justice, and access, both on campus as well as throughout our community.  We believe that diversity makes us a stronger community as we look to prepare students to operate in a global society. Our office collaborates with students, faculty, staff, alumni, and community members to provide innovative and purposeful programming that reflects our diverse and changing world. Additionally, DEIA is the official designee of the college president to ensure that the campus abides by all federal and state laws and SUNY policies with regard to discrimination on the basis of race, sex, ethnicity, national origin, sexual orientation, gender identity, religion, age, disability or marital or veteran status.

Presidents Council on Equity and Campus Diversity

The President’s Council on Equity and Campus Diversity aims to address discrimination, harassment, and campus climate issues as they relate to the recruitment and retention of students, faculty, staff curriculum development, and student life on campus.
